The voyeuristic husband of a depraved woman lets himself be locked in a room while his wife indulges herself in wild sexual experiences.
Directors
Directors
Box office
Budget
$0Gross worldwide
$0The voyeuristic husband of a depraved woman lets himself be locked in a room while his wife indulges herself in wild sexual experiences.
Directors
Directors
Budget
$0Gross worldwide
$0